AmazonWatcher Frequently Asked Questions


What is AmazonWatcher?
AmazonWatcher is a software tool that can monitor availability and price drop of the products on Amazon.com.

Why is a "Not yet released" item shown as "in stock" in AmazonWatcher?
Well, as long as the item is available for pre-order on Amazon.com, it is guaranteed to be available on the release date. So technically it is in stock, since it can be ordered NOW.

Does AmazonWatcher check price information of third-party items?
No, currently AmazonWatcher only checks items that are sold by Amazon. In the future we might add support for third-party items.

Why did automatic purchasing fail?
To make automatic purchasing work, your Amazon's 1-Click setting needs to have a default shipping address with a credit card associated with it (No, you don't have to turn on the 1-Click ordering feature). To test if your account has it, just place an item into the cart and check out. If after you log in, you are immediately brought to the last ordering step with order summary, then you are all set. Otherwise, if you are brought to the shipping address selection page, the automatic purchasing may not work.
